/* === Mobile devices - Portrait (320px wide) === */

@media only screen and (min-width: 20em) {

}
/* === Mobile devices - Landscape (480px wide) === */

@media only screen and (min-width: 30em) {

}
/* === Tablet devices - Portrait (768px wide) === */

@media only screen and (min-width: 48em) {

}
/* === Tablet devices - Landscape (900px wide) === */

@media only screen and (min-width: 56.25em) {

}
/* === Netbook devices (1100px wide) === */

@media only screen and (min-width: 68.75em) {

}
/* === Desktop devices (1300px wide) === */

@media only screen and (min-width: 81.25em) {


}
/* === Desktop devices (1600px wide) === */

@media only screen and (min-width: 81.25em) {

}




/* Responsive elements */

@media (max-width: 1050px) {
    /* Information Boxes */

    .info-box.icon-wrapper {
        padding-left: 50px;
    }
    .info-box.icon-wrapper .icon-large {
        font-size: 70px;
    }
    .info-box .stats {
        font-size: 20px;
    }
    .info-box b {
        overflow: hidden;
        white-space: nowrap;
        text-overflow: ellipsis;
    }


/*Raj css start*/
	
.mene_sec .navbar-default .navbar-nav > li > a{ margin:0 !important}

.mene_sec .nav > li > a	{ padding:10px 12px;}
}


@media (max-width:980px) {
	.mene_sec .navbar-default .navbar-nav > li > a{ font-size:12px !important;}
	.mene_sec .nav > li > a{ padding:5px 6px;}
	
	.important-button {
    padding: 6px 7px !important;
    float: right;
    margin: 6px 0 0 0;
    font-size: 11px !important;
}




}

/*Raj css end*/

@media screen and (max-width:767px) {
	

/*************Raj css start***********/

.table-responsive-new{ overflow-x:scroll;}
	
.pay_credit_card .form-horizontal .control-label, .form-horizontal .radio, .form-horizontal .checkbox, .form-horizontal .radio-inline, .form-horizontal .checkbox-inline{ margin-bottom:10px;}
 	
.pay_credit_card{ margin-bottom:0;}
.pay_credit_card .bordered-row > .form-group{ padding:0 0 5px 0;}
.pay_credit_card .example-box-wrapper .icon-box, .example-box-wrapper .ui-slider, .example-box-wrapper .ui-rangeSlider, .example-box-wrapper .panel-layout, .example-box-wrapper .image-box, .example-box-wrapper .ui-accordion, .example-box-wrapper .dashboard-box, .example-box-wrapper .content-box, .example-box-wrapper .tile-box, .example-box-wrapper .jvectormap-container, .example-box-wrapper > .hasDatepicker, .example-box-wrapper > .minicolors, .example-box-wrapper .minicolors, .example-box-wrapper .ui-tabs, .example-box-wrapper > img, .example-box-wrapper > .thumbnail, .example-box-wrapper > .img-humbnail, .example-box-wrapper > .display-block.dropdown-menu, .example-box-wrapper > .dropdown, .example-box-wrapper > .dropup, .example-box-wrapper > form, .example-box-wrapper > .progressbar, .example-box-wrapper .loading-spinner, .example-box-wrapper .loading-stick, .example-box-wrapper .nav, .example-box-wrapper .jcrop-holder, .example-box-wrapper .alert, .example-box-wrapper .list-group, .example-box-wrapper > h6, .example-box-wrapper .dataTables_wrapper, .example-box-wrapper .scrollable-content, .example-box-wrapper > .pagination, .example-box-wrapper > .btn-group-vertical, .example-box-wrapper > .btn-toolbar, .example-box-wrapper > .btn-group, .example-box-wrapper > .btn, .example-box-wrapper > .panel-layout{ margin-bottom:0;}


 
 
 .dropdown-menu {
    position: fixed;
    left: 0 !important;
    width: 100%;
    border-radius: 0;	
}

.action_btn  .dropdown-menu { position:relative;}


.box-sm{ width:auto;}	
	
	.newsevents{ padding:0px;}	
.newsevents .panel-body{ padding:15px 0;} 
	
	.mobileheadernone{ display:none;}

		.important-button {

    float: left !important;
    font-size: 13px !important;
	    padding: 10px 15px !important;
}

	
	}


@media screen and (max-width: 650px) {
    .mobile-hidden {
        display: none !important;
    }
    .mobile-buttons a.btn {
        display: block;
        float: none;
        min-width: 1px;
        max-width: 100%;
        margin: 0 0 5px;
    }
    .heading-1 .heading-content {
        width: 80%;
    }
    .heading-1 small {
        overflow: hidden;
        text-overflow: ellipsis;
    }
    .content-box .content-box-wrapper {
        padding: 5px;
    }
    .popover {
        min-width: 100px !important;
    }
    .medium-box,
    .scrollable-small {
        width: 300px !important;
    }
    /* Chats */

    .chat-box li {
        padding-right: 50px;
    }
    .chat-box li.float-left {
        padding-left: 50px;
    }
    .chat-box .popover .popover-content {
        font-size: 11px;
        line-height: 1.5em;
        padding: 5px;
    }
    .chat-box .chat-author img {
        width: 34px;
        min-width: 34px;
    }
    /* Notifications */

    .notifications-box li .notification-text {
        display: block;
        overflow: hidden;
        width: 44%;
        white-space: nowrap;
        text-overflow: ellipsis;
    }
    .notifications-box li .notification-time {
        margin: 0;
    }
    /* Messages */

    .messages-box li .messages-text {
        overflow: hidden;
        width: 100%;
        white-space: nowrap;
        text-overflow: ellipsis;
    }
	
	/*Raj css start*/
	
	
.pay_credit_card .col-xs-1, .col-xs-2, .col-xs-3, .col-xs-4, .col-xs-5, .col-xs-6, .col-xs-7, .col-xs-8, .col-xs-9, .col-xs-10, .col-xs-11, .col-xs-12, .col-sm-1, .col-sm-2, .col-sm-3, .col-sm-4, .col-sm-5, .col-sm-6, .col-sm-7, .col-sm-8, .col-sm-9, .col-sm-10, .col-sm-11, .col-sm-12, .col-md-1, .col-md-2, .col-md-3, .col-md-4, .col-md-5, .col-md-6, .col-md-7, .col-md-8, .col-md-9, .col-md-10, .col-md-11, .col-md-12, .col-lg-1, .col-lg-2, .col-lg-3, .col-lg-4, .col-lg-5, .col-lg-6, .col-lg-7, .col-lg-8, .col-lg-9, .col-lg-10, .col-lg-11, .col-lg-12{ margin-bottom:5px !important;}

.pay_credit_card .fontsize17 p{ font-size:14px;}



}

@media screen and (min-width:120px) and (max-width:767px) {
	
	.sunil{display:none !important;
}

.neeraj{display:block !important;
}
	
}